Production Scheduling Software

Production Scheduling Software helps manufacturers in efficiently planning and organizing various production schedules. It assists monitor resource utilization and optimize production time to get maximum production capacity.

The solution also permits manufacturers to assign tasks to workers, check stock inventories, release bottlenecks, and manage many other aspects of the production cycle to get production a smooth run. It helps to forecast demands and plan the production cycle accordingly. The four components of production scheduling has the following:

Planning – The planning part of production scheduling is the most important. The planning component assists to deciding in advance what must be done in the future – which is the most crucial step in production scheduling. Without any planning, production scheduling can not even start or take place. Preparing a plan charts, budgets for production , and many other visual representations can give a sound basis for steps down the road pertaining to production.

Routing – Production routing is the process that pertains to determining the route or path that a product must follow. This route entails the path from raw materials until it transform into a finished product. The main objective of this component is to locate and perform the most economical and enhanced sequence of operations in the production process.

Scheduling – Scheduling goes with the time and date which is most important operation and must be completed. Scheduling is an important and critical portion of production scheduling and well lays the foundation and groundwork for all steps within the production procedure. There are three types of scheduling which must be utilized as operations like manufacturing or operation scheduling, master scheduling, and retail operation scheduling. Overall, scheduling is important for a manufacturing operation to keep pace.

Dispatching – Dispatching correlates to the procedure of starting production with a preconceived production plan. Dispatching is concerned with providing a practical shape to the overall production plan. This will also have to issue orders and instructions and other important information pertaining to production.

Advantages of Production Scheduling Software

Production scheduling software provides manufacturers many benefits, not just in the production cycle but the whole business. Here are the primary advantages :

  • The software provides real-time information on the availability of raw materials, resources, and equipment as well as machine status. Having all the information on a single interface assists manufacturers in creating to optimize production schedules. This enhances productivity and gives higher profits.
  • Streamlines collaboration among departments: Production scheduling software is utilized by almost every department, from procurement to dispatch and purchase to sales. Single-window access assists departments collaborate and track the live production status. This makes it easy to synchronize information for a smooth production cycle.
  • Loosens bottlenecks: It can be difficult to manually for tracking a large volume of resources and remember reordering schedules. Product scheduling software monitors stock quantities and reminds to reorder stock. An organized workflow assists production managers easily identify and remove bottlenecks to avoid disruptions in the production cycle.

Features of Production Scheduling Software

Automated scheduling: Setting up rule-based algorithms for automatically scheduling production plans based on resource availability and business demands.

Capacity planning: Determining the organization’s production capacity to get fluctuating demands met.

Material requirement planning (MRP): Allowing manufacturers to analyze material availability and planning future material requirements for completing orders.

“What-if” analysis: Helping production managers for analyzing potential production schedules and alternating approaches in case of the disruptive events and issues which may hinder production.

Change management: Analyzing the impact of disruptive changes in demand on production cycles and supporting change implementation.

Scheduling: Assigning schedules to workers and keeping a tab on the actual production for scheduling production operations.

Considerations While Buying Production Scheduling Software

Ease of use: Production scheduling solution can be used by anyone, from technically-sound production managers to technology novices. Because the manufacturing industry has a high attrition rate, the solution chosen should have a short learning curve and be easy to use. Participating in free trials and demos gives you a feel of the solution. You can even ask your employees to test and evaluate the tool before taking a decision.

Support and service commitments: Abrupt halts in the production cycle can result in huge losses. These could be due to the production scheduling software failing. That’s why we recommend choosing a vendor who is available for support when you need it. Ask your vendor about the support options before making a purchase decision.

Remote accessibility: Production managers and engineers need to constantly move around the work floor to ensure that machines and resources are working properly. To do that, they need production schedules and details in-hand all the time. Therefore, the software you select should be accessible on mobile phones and tablets.

Production Scheduling Software Trends

IoT will positively impact production schedules: Manufacturers are implementing IoT technology in their production operations, as 63% of them believe that IoT will benefit their production. Nearly one-third of the existing production equipment and processes have embedded IoT devices that collect a wide range of data in real time. This data can be analyzed to help businesses predict better production schedules and improve their production cycle.

Big data, predictive analytics to improve production scheduling: Modern solutions can collect huge volumes of data and use predictive analytics or machine-learning algorithms to create production schedules with greater accuracy. These solutions collect data such as machine status, equipment health, raw material cost and availability, and seasonal changes in demand.
